







USB 2.0 to FireWire IEEE 1394 4-Pin Data Cable (Passive, Non-Converting)
The USB 2.0 to FireWire IEEE 1394 4-Pin Data Cable is a passive data cable designed for specific legacy device connections where FireWire and USB compatibility is already supported at the device and system level.
This cable features a USB 2.0 Type-A male connector on one end and a 4-pin IEEE 1394 (FireWire / i.LINK) male connector on the other. It is not a protocol converter and does not convert FireWire signals to USB or enable DV video capture via USB.
ā ļø Important compatibility notice (please read before purchasing):
⢠This cable does not convert FireWire to USB
⢠USB ports cannot capture FireWire DV video using this cable
⢠Will not work with FireWire-only DV camcorders for video capture
⢠Requires hardware and software that already support FireWire-over-USB operation
This cable is typically used for very specific legacy or OEM applications where the device manufacturer explicitly states compatibility with this type of connection.
